ā¬‡ļø Nourishing your body tip #1ā¬‡ļø
Learn what your body needs in terms of macronutrients.
Don’t just track and forget it. Pay attention. That doesn’t mean you have to track all the time, etc., but you do need to be aware of what your body needs in terms of protein, carbohydrates, and healthy fats.
Learning what you need and how your body feels can feel a little confusing at first, but eventually, you’ll just know—and once you know, you can’t ā€œunknow.ā€ It’s hard to ignore it once you’re aware of how great or terrible foods make you feel. You certainly don’t have to track everything you eat to practice awareness. For example, if you eat a hefty portion of carbohydrates early in the day, you’re probably aware that you need to focus on getting in your protein and fat for the rest of the day. You don’t have to obsess about it, but if you want proper nourishment to become your lifestyle, you need to be aware of what your body needs (and how it feels) at the very least. šŸ‘Œ
